Financial Trend Analysis
Financially, Vistar Amar Ltd is performing exceptionally well. The company’s financial grade is outstanding, driven by robust growth in operating profit and net sales. As of 26 April 2026, operating profit has grown at an annual rate of 26.86%, while net sales for the nine months ending December 2025 reached ₹104.54 crores, marking a remarkable growth of 343.15%. Profit Before Tax (PBT) excluding other income for the quarter stood at ₹7.68 crores, reflecting a staggering 7,780% increase compared to the previous four-quarter average. Similarly, Profit After Tax (PAT) for the quarter was ₹6.47 crores, up by 2,795.8% over the same period. These figures highlight the company’s strong earnings momentum and operational efficiency.
Technical Outlook
From a technical standpoint, the stock maintains a bullish grade, indicating positive price momentum and favourable chart patterns. Despite a recent one-day decline of 4.99%, the stock has delivered impressive returns over various time frames. Over the past month, it has gained 10.21%, while the three-month and six-month returns stand at 69.65% and 59.43% respectively. Year-to-date, the stock has surged by 85.77%, and over the last year, it has generated a return of 52.36%, significantly outperforming the BSE500 index’s 1.34% return in the same period.
